Output 14342bf038200a8f8b0e8ca8f538efc8616714d7994e089e17c3b906f5998a7e:15

value
756384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0be7e31254f04a3c2ce824c6c3089afa8e55145d OP_EQUAL
address
32my9SmEfXY6KLLBpi9KFR39xGoGfCDsTq
transaction
14342bf038200a8f8b0e8ca8f538efc8616714d7994e089e17c3b906f5998a7e
spent
true